|
23 | 23 | </div> |
24 | 24 | <noscript> |
25 | 25 | <div style="color:#CC0000; text-align:center"> |
26 | | - Besoin de Javascript pour afficher certaines listes. |
| 26 | + Besoin de JavaScript pour afficher certaines listes. |
27 | 27 | </div> |
28 | 28 | </noscript> |
29 | 29 | <script>EMULISP_CORE.loadLisp("microalg.l");</script> |
|
113 | 113 | flottants</a>. |
114 | 114 |
|
115 | 115 | *EN DÉTAILS* |
116 | | -Dans les versions reposant sur Javascript, c’est-à-dire dans le navigateur mais |
| 116 | +Dans les versions reposant sur JavaScript, c’est-à-dire dans le navigateur mais |
117 | 117 | aussi hors web grâce à |
118 | 118 | <a href="https://developer.mozilla.org/fr/docs/Rhino" class="offi">Rhino</a> ou |
119 | 119 | <a href="http://fr.wikipedia.org/wiki/Node.js" class="wp">NodeJS</a>, |
|
420 | 420 | * écrire d’autres tutoriels, par exemple pour détailler un sujet précis ; |
421 | 421 | * compétences en **visuels numériques**, **HTML/CSS** : |
422 | 422 | * travailler sur l’apparence du site ; |
423 | | -* compétences en **développement** (Java, Javascript, jQuery, PicoLisp…) : |
| 423 | +* compétences en **développement** (Java, JavaScript, jQuery, PicoLisp…) : |
424 | 424 | * améliorer l’interface web ; |
425 | 425 | * applis Android ou iOS, installateurs pour Mac ou PC ; |
426 | 426 | * construire de nouvelles interfaces, par exemple avec GeoGebra ; |
|
449 | 449 | * JVM : pour <a href="http://fr.wikipedia.org/wiki/Machine_virtuelle_Java" |
450 | 450 | class="wp">Java Virtual Machine</a>, |
451 | 451 | exécute du byte-code Java |
452 | | -* Rhino : plateforme en Java pur permettant d’interpréter du code Javascript |
| 452 | +* Rhino : plateforme en Java pur permettant d’interpréter du code JavaScript |
453 | 453 | (voir <a href="http://fr.wikipedia.org/wiki/Rhino_%28moteur_JavaScript%29" |
454 | 454 | class="wp">l’article Wikipedia</a>) |
455 | | -* NodeJS : plateforme permettant d’interpréter du code Javascript |
| 455 | +* NodeJS : plateforme permettant d’interpréter du code JavaScript |
456 | 456 | (voir <a href="http://fr.wikipedia.org/wiki/Nodejs" |
457 | 457 | class="wp">l’article Wikipedia</a>) |
458 | 458 | * browser : le navigateur (Internet) installé sur la MACHINE |
459 | 459 | * PicoLisp : la version officielle du langage hôte, PicoLisp |
460 | 460 | * Ersatz : implémentation en Java de PicoLisp |
461 | | -* EmuLisp : implémentation en Javascript de PicoLisp |
| 461 | +* EmuLisp : implémentation en JavaScript de PicoLisp |
462 | 462 | * `pil`, `pil-j`, `pil-rjs` et `pil-njs` : les interpréteurs des |
463 | 463 | implémentations de PicoLisp |
464 | 464 | * `microalg.l` : le fichier définissant le langage MicroAlg |
|
476 | 476 | <a href="http://fr.wikipedia.org/wiki/Lisp" class="wp">Lisp</a>, nommé |
477 | 477 | <a href="http://picolisp.com/" class="offi">PicoLisp</a>. |
478 | 478 | Ce dernier est implémenté au moins avec trois langages, C+ASM, Java et |
479 | | -Javascript. |
| 479 | +JavaScript. |
480 | 480 |
|
481 | 481 | * En C+ASM, c’est la version dite *officielle* |
482 | 482 | d’[Alexander Burger](http://software-lab.de/). |
483 | 483 | * En Java, c’est l’implémentation nommée Ersatz et réalisée par le créateur de |
484 | 484 | PicoLisp lui-même. |
485 | | -* En Javascript, c’est l’implémentation nommée EmuLisp, réalisée par |
| 485 | +* En JavaScript, c’est l’implémentation nommée EmuLisp, réalisée par |
486 | 486 | [Jon Kleiser](http://folk.uio.no/jkleiser/), dont je suis quasiment le seul |
487 | 487 | utilisateur, et que je maintiens dans un |
488 | 488 | [dépôt semi-officiel](https://github.com/grahack/emulisp). |
|
560 | 560 | travailler qu’avec les nombres entiers. |
561 | 561 | * Pour finir, la version Rhino+EmuLisp (`malg-rjs`) est bonne dernière. En |
562 | 562 | effet, elle est à la fois pénalisée par Java et par l’interprétation avec |
563 | | - Javascript. Néanmoins, elle permet de travailler avec les nombres flottants |
| 563 | + JavaScript. Néanmoins, elle permet de travailler avec les nombres flottants |
564 | 564 | avec le minimum d’installation de la part de l’utilisateur. |
565 | 565 |
|
566 | 566 | ## Intégrations |
|
0 commit comments